2. Are you a recent graduate who has, within the previous two years, completed or will complete by the date indicated in the job announcement, a qualifying Associate's, Bachelors, Masters, Doctorate, professional, vocational or technical degree or certificate program?

Note: Veterans unable to apply within two years of receiving their degree due to military service obligation have up to six years after degree completion to apply.

2. Participate in regional teams on policies that will support the organization's strategy.
